Community Tasting Notes 16

  • Burgundy Al wrote: 92 points

    June 1, 2022 - (Mostly) Burgundy Dinner with Friends (Formento's - Chicago IL): Still amazingly fresh, this has so much bright black cherry and berry throughout with excellent balance and depth, nicely supported with braised meat and faint liqueur. Lots here, all perfectly harmonious. No hurry to drink up.

  • Burgnick Likes this wine: 92 points

    April 13, 2020 - Wild berries, musk, animal and feral. Quintessial Gevrey. Lots of underlying power especially for a prem cru. Good balance between fruit and acidity. Across the board from this prem cru to his Griotte in the 98 village has been consistently great. While the 95 prem cru is about elegance , the 98 prem cru is about power. 92+

  • Burgundy Al wrote: 92 points

    November 13, 2018 - Open an hour+ before serving. Mature black cherry and plum with braised meat, earth and slightly sweet spice with an exotic touch. Good depth and length, this stayed persistent and alluring over the course of several hours in glass.

  • Burgundy Al wrote: 91 points

    May 14, 2016 - Burgundy Dinner with Friends (Brindille - Chicago IL): Closed and austere to start, this was decanted and kept opening up and improving over the next hour+. Black fruit cross-section with sauvage and earth. Tannins a bit firm to start, then more elegant by the end.

  • Burgundy Al wrote: 91 points

    July 22, 2014 - Lots of fresh black cherries and berries with good power and savory spice. Not quite as exciting as the last few bottles from the same case, this bottle seemed to display a bit more pronounced new oak.
